We are looking for a motivated and enthusiastic Junior Business Development Executive to join our growing sales team. This is an excellent opportunity for someone looking to begin or develop a career in sales within the telecoms industry. The role will focus on speaking with warm customers and existing contacts, verifying contract end dates, building relationships, and identifying future opportunities. You will receive ongoing coaching, support, and product training with a clear development pathway into a fully‑fledged Business Development Executive role, where you’ll manage the full sales process independently. This role would suit someone who enjoys speaking with people, is organised, curious, and eager to learn in a supportive team environment. We would love to welcome you to our Crewe office, working hours of Monday‑Friday 8:30am – 5:00pm.
Responsibilities
- Contact warm customer data to verify contract end dates and business information
- Build positive relationships with customers through professional and engaging conversations
- Develop knowledge of our full suite of telecoms products and solutions
- Clearly explain the features and benefits of our products in a simple and customer‑focused way
- Work closely with key partners across the major mobile and telecom networks
- Support the wider sales team by identifying qualified opportunities
- Provide excellent after‑sales service to ensure customers are fully satisfied
- Identify opportunities for additional orders, referrals, and future business
- Maintain accurate customer records and notes within internal systems
- Participate in ongoing training, coaching, and development sessions
